Mackay Hospital board sacked after horror report, Health Minister confirms

The entire Mackay Hospital and Health Services board has been sacked after a damning report into the hospital’s obstetrics and gynaecology department.
It was last month revealed inadequate care led to botched surgeries and the deaths of babies.
Health Minister Yvette D’Ath said she dismissed the board on November 4 after a show cause notice was issued in September.
She said she was “not satisfied that the board is able to implement the recommendations of the report, including the cultural change needed” across the hospital.
“I was satisfied that it is in the public interest that all members of the board be dismissed.”
An administrator has been appointed in their place.
